This full‑time associate lecturer position in Medical Imaging (Education and Scholarship) is available from July 2026 to April 2027 on a fixed term. The role involves lecturing, practical teaching, seminars, tutorials, pastoral care, and academic administration for BSc/MSci (Hons) Medical Imaging, apprenticeship programmes, MSc and PhD students.
Responsibilities
- Deliver undergraduate and postgraduate teaching across lecture and practical sessions.
- Provide pastoral support and tutorial guidance to students.
- Carry out academic administrative duties as required.
Qualifications
- PhD (or near completion) in Diagnostic Radiography or equivalent specialist knowledge.
- Demonstrated teaching experience and commitment to person‑centred practice.
- Expected to achieve Associate Fellow of the HEA within two years.
Benefits
- Starting salary £33,951‑£39,906 on Grade E.
- Part‑time or job‑sharing arrangements welcomed.
- Sector‑leading maternity, adoption and shared parental leave (up to 26 weeks full pay).
